Jeera, saunf, ajwain and elaichi: 6 benefits of consuming this mix after meals

Jeera, saunf, ajwain and elaichi: 6 benefits of consuming this mix after meals
One spice blend can help prevent several issues at once, whether you're trying to reduce excess weight or eliminate bloating. You should try Jeera, saunf, ajwain and elaichi together. These seeds provide a number of health advantages for your general well-being when consumed right after meals.

Here’s how to prepare it:

IngredientsOne spoon ajwainHalf spoon jeeraOne fourth saunf5 elaichi podsPreparationRoast everything in a tadka panGrind them to make a powder.Consume with one glass of Luke warm water every night before bed.

Benefits of consuming this mix after meals:

Relieve body painIt is a pain reliever. It's not exactly a magic potion that'll banish all your aches and pains. Bt the essential oils in these seeds have an anti-inflammatory effect on your body which can curb body pain when consumed every day.Boosts gut healthConsume this spice mix every night post dinner because it works like a gentle hug for our tummy. It can help soothe indigestion, bloating, and gas, which can sometimes be linked to discomfort and also chronic body pains. Your gut health will be blessed with better gut flora and enhanced digestion.
Heal migraineWhile it might not be your go-to for a migraine, this spice mix can definitely help with that uncomfortable feeling of a heavy head after eating. Migraine relief through this mix happens due to the presence of healing compounds like Thymol in ajwain. Have this powder with warm water before bed, and you’ll sleep like a baby.Digestive delightIf you often deal with heartburn and heaviness in the stomach post-meals, this must be your go-to remedy. This mix (jeera, saunf, ajwain, and elaichi) is like a dream team for your digestive system. They work together to keep things moving smoothly, reducing bloating and gas. Respiratory reliefGreen elaichi, the elegant addition to this mix, can help soothe your throat and clear up congestion. It's like a little breath of fresh air for your lungs. The spice mix helps in detoxing your lungs and improve breathing. Antioxidant armor Green elaichi is packed with antioxidants, which are like tiny superheroes fighting off harmful free radicals. This spice mix can heal your body from inside and prevent wear and tear that happens in the body on a daily basis. If you're experiencing persistent body aches, it's crucial to consult a healthcare professional to determine the underlying cause and receive appropriate treatment. They may recommend medications, physical therapy, or other interventions to manage your pain effectively. While this herbal remedy can be a helpful addition to your wellness routine for digestive and respiratory health, it's important to prioritize medical advice for chronic conditions.
